Damascus was the Syrian capital where Hazael was to be anointed king; Syria’s conflict with Israel made his rise an instrument of judgment. Beersheba and Mount Horeb mark Elijah’s flight to the southern wilderness and covenant mountain, while Abel-meholah was Elisha’s home east of the Jordan, from which he would succeed Elijah.
